What is a 45 Foot Shipping Container?
A 45-foot shipping container, likewise referred to as a 45-foot ISO (International Organization for Standardization) 45ft container storage, is a standardized unit utilized in maritime, rail, and road logistics. It measures 45 feet in length, 8 feet in width, and 9.5 feet in height, making it slightly longer than the more common 40-foot container. This extra length offers additional cargo space, which can be important for businesses dealing with larger volumes of items.

Secret Features of 45 Foot Shipping Containers
Dimensions:
- Length: 45 feet (13.716 meters)
- Width: 8 feet (2.438 meters)
- Height: 9.5 feet (2.9 meters)
- Interior Volume: Approximately 3,466 cubic feet (98.17 cubic meters)
Weight Capacity:
- Maximum Gross Weight: 67,200 pounds (30,481 kg)
- Tare Weight: 10,130 pounds (4,593 kg)
- Payload Capacity: 57,070 pounds (25,888 kg)
Structural Strength:
- Constructed from top-quality corten steel, these containers are built to stand up to extreme weather, rough handling, and long-distance travel.
- The robust structure guarantees that products remain safe and intact during transit.
Doors and Access:
- Standard 45-foot containers include double doors at one end, enabling for easy loading and discharging of cargo.
- Some variants, known as high-cube containers, may have an additional door at the front or side for even greater accessibility.
Flexibility:
- 45-foot containers can be modified for various usages, including refrigerated units (reefers) for perishables, open-top containers for large cargo, and flat-rack containers for heavy machinery.
Applications of 45 Foot Shipping Containers
General Cargo Transport:
- These Heavy-duty 45ft containers are ideal for transporting a large range of products, from electronic devices and textiles to furnishings and automobile parts.
- The additional length permits for more efficient usage of space, minimizing the number of containers needed for big shipments.
Cooled Goods:
- Reefer containers are specially developed to preserve a consistent temperature level, making them ideal for carrying perishable items such as fruits, veggies, and pharmaceuticals.
- The 45-foot reefer can accommodate more temperature-sensitive cargo than its 40-foot counterpart, ensuring that organizations can fulfill their logistical needs without jeopardizing on quality.
Heavy Machinery and Equipment:
- Flat-rack and open-top containers provide the versatility needed to carry large and heavy equipment.
- These variations permit the secure loading and discharging of items that do not fit into standard containers, such as cranes, boats, and building and construction devices.
Modular Construction:
- 45-foot containers can be repurposed for modular construction tasks, providing ready-made units for real estate, workplaces, and retail spaces.
- The included length provides more functional area, making these containers attractive for organizations and people trying to find quick and budget-friendly building solutions.
Storage Solutions:
- Many organizations and people utilize 45-foot shipping containers as short-term or permanent storage options.
- The large interior volume makes them appropriate for keeping inventory, equipment, and personal valuables, using a safe and secure and weather-resistant environment.
Benefits of Using 45 Foot Shipping Containers
Increased Efficiency:
- The additional space in a 45 foot long containers-foot container allows companies to combine deliveries, decreasing transportation expenses and minimizing the number of containers needed.
- This effectiveness can result in significant cost savings in logistics expenses and enhanced supply chain management.
Cost-Effectiveness:
- While the initial cost of a 45-foot container may be higher than that of a 40-foot container, the increased capacity typically results in lower per-unit shipping costs.
- Services can likewise minimize warehousing expenses by utilizing these containers for on-site storage.
Sturdiness and Security:
- The high-grade building and construction materials utilized in 45-foot containers ensure that they can handle the rigors of long-distance transportation.
- Safe locking mechanisms and robust walls protect products from theft, damage, and environmental factors.
Versatility in Use:
- 45-foot containers can be adapted for various purposes, from transportation to storage and modular building and construction.
- This flexibility makes them an important asset for services and individuals with diverse logistical requirements.
Environmental Benefits:
- By minimizing the number of containers required for large shipments, 45 Foot Shipping Container-foot containers can assist lower carbon emissions and environmental effect.
- Repurposing used containers for storage and building projects also promotes sustainability by minimizing waste.
Challenges and Considerations
Ease of access:
- The bigger size of 45-foot containers may position difficulties for filling and dumping, specifically in centers with restricted space.
- Specialized equipment may be needed to manage these containers, which can contribute to operational costs.
Transport:
- While 45-foot containers are widely accepted in maritime transportation, their use in rail and road logistics may be more limited due to infrastructure constraints.
- It is important to contact transport providers to ensure that 45-foot containers are an option for the designated mode of transportation.
Storage:
- The larger size of 45-foot containers might need more space for storage, which can be a consideration for organizations with limited storage facilities.
- Proper planning and site preparation are required to ensure that these containers can be safely and efficiently saved.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How much more cargo can a 45-foot container hold compared to a 40-foot container?
- A 45-foot container has an extra 5 feet of length, which equates to approximately 15% more cargo space compared to a 40-foot container.
Q2: Are 45-foot containers more costly to rent or acquire?
- Yes, 45-foot containers usually cost more to rent or buy due to their bigger size and increased capacity. However, the cost per unit volume is often lower, making them affordable for big shipments.
Q3: Can 45-foot containers be used for roadway and rail transport?
- While 45-foot containers are widely utilized in maritime transport, their usage in road and rail logistics may be more limited. It is very important to validate with transport service providers to make sure compatibility.
Q4: What are the common adjustments readily available for 45-foot containers?
- Typical modifications include reefer units for temperature-controlled items, open-top containers for extra-large cargo, and flat-rack containers for heavy machinery.
Q5: How do 45-foot containers benefit modular building projects?
- The larger size of 45-foot containers offers more functional space, making them perfect for modular building tasks such as short-lived real estate, offices, and retail spaces. They can be rapidly and easily put together, using a cost-efficient and versatile structure solution.
Q6: Are 45-foot containers appropriate for long-term storage?
- Yes, 45-foot containers are extremely suitable for long-term storage due to their sturdiness and secure style. They can safeguard goods from environmental factors and are frequently used as on-site storage options.
Q7: How do I select the best 45-foot container for my needs?
- Consider the type of cargo you will be transferring, the mode of transport, and any specific requirements such as temperature control. Consulting with a logistics provider can assist you make a notified choice.
